A little piece of history

The hotel building was magificent and our suite was very well appointed and comfortable. Good bed and plenty of space.The location was excellent for visiting the area and allowed us to make use of both train and boat and leave the car (for free) at the hotel. The restaurant however was average and on the one occasion we ate there we were bothered by the midges which were in abundance.Reception satf couldn’t have been more helpful but there was one seemingly everpresent lady in the dining room/bar who was anything but helpful.We probably wouldn’t go back but that is more to do with a sense that we have visited the area and there are other places to explore.

Classical Spanish Hotel

Myself and wife got married in Gibraltar in the morning and then made our way to El Puerto de Santa Maria, just outside Jerez to stay in the Beautiful Hotel Duques De Medinaceli. It was like staying in a museum with huge decorative paintings and mirrors, couryards, fountains, gardens and so on. I really can’t say enough about the hotel, I’ll definetly be going back. Service was so good it was scary, I remember putting the phone down after requesting something and there was an almost instantaneous knock on the door, (it reminded me of the butler character out of Mr. Deeds - sneaky sneaky!). Definetly worth going out of your way to stay in this hotel if even only for one night. It was very romantic for me and my new wife.

A real beauty

This is a beautiful hotel in the centre of Puerto. The hotel was the family home of the De Terry family which was, until recently, one of the major sherry producing families of the area. There is a large and peaceful garden which is surprising for such a central hotel. The staff are friendly and service efficient.

Take the old ferry boat to Cadiz - the same boat has been plying the stretch of water from Puerto to Cadiz for at least 40 years and is a relaxing way to reach this fantaistic city.
